Originally Posted by slawecki
you could set up an account with an international bank with hdqts in us. Citi comes to mind. do not know exchange rate.
Unfortunately this may not be practical if she is not resident in Europe. Despite being a US bank and her being a US citizen, local laws will apply and it might be a real hassle to get the account opened.

If she wishes to go this route, it may be worth considering an "offshore" account such as HSBC in Jersey or some such. They may let her make deposits in their branches in Europe. (Doubt its that simple, unless you're depositing in the UK.)
